    Really informative video, thank you! Your concluding points about corrosion, scrapes/deformation, and setback was really insightful and what I was looking for. So much of the online and in-person conversation about when to switch ccw ammo is based on some time intervals and it always felt moot to me since we're talking about a cartridge like its expiring food at a grocery store rather than a definitive mechanical system that can reliably operate within its tolerances
